Notes about Claes Harmens "offte Knol"


The Groninger Knol family is an old, rich and considerable farming family, that occurs very early with a family name and family crest.

The oldest sure ancestor is Claes Harmens "offte Knol", farmer and horse merchant in Startenhuizen, which was then part of Eppenhuizen.
Claes Harmens is the presumably son of Harmen Knol and Hijke, who entered the first half of the 16th century lived on "De Knol" in the kerspel Eelswerd on the Knolweg.

In 1590 Claes Hermans "offte Knoll" still lived in a 'heerdt tie Eppingahuyzen'. This Claes was guilty of trading outside staple law around 1550 from the city of Groningen (see "The Chronicle of Abel Eppens tho Equart", p. 131).

Knol means Dingstede (= Richtsheuvel) and was a small piece of land on the north side of the church. There the targeting was exercised and the nearby farm got its name "offte Knoll" from that place.

Source: K.J.Ritzema van Ikema "Ommelander Geslachten V" - page 323
